Output 71ef619f4478458ec30988646bbd0c38f077ad4c34694b349af001f9a18f0abf:0

value
1145730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f30a93165d700e993eaad627729b8406ae10de OP_EQUAL
address
3L1YDiUVQxoxbBsM6PDVrk69ekCKGrbJqM
transaction
71ef619f4478458ec30988646bbd0c38f077ad4c34694b349af001f9a18f0abf
confirmations
176256
spent
true